Some parts of care should not be improvised

A general guide can organize questions, but it cannot examine the individual animal, test water or blood, identify a pathogen, calculate a drug, certify legal status, or formulate a complete diet from household ingredients. Those decisions need the appropriate veterinarian, nutritionist, wildlife official, or licensing authority. Bring exact observations about day geckos instead of conclusions: dates, quantities, photographs, video, environmental readings, product names, and changes in behavior or waste. That information lets a professional make parasite prevention and monitoring more precise while reducing delays caused by a vague history or an attempted home diagnosis.

A detail generic pet advice misses

Because day geckos are ectothermic, parasite prevention and monitoring must be interpreted alongside basking surface temperature, cooler retreat, UVB where required, hydration method, and humidity cycle. A room that feels warm to a person can still provide the wrong gradient. Measure where the animal actually sits and confirm that light and heat sources cannot burn it.

Nutrition that fits this species

A complete day-gecko or crested-gecko style diet plus suitable insects and veterinary supplementation. Rotate suitable feeder species instead of relying on one insect. Feed the feeders a sound diet before use, remove uneaten prey that can bite or stress the animal, and follow a veterinarian’s calcium and vitamin schedule. Prey size, feeding time, and access matter as much as the shopping list. Keep that nutrition baseline visible while making decisions about parasite prevention and monitoring.

Have a veterinary threshold

Urgent warning signs for day geckos include open-mouth breathing away from normal basking, loss of righting response, prolapse, major burns, severe trauma, or sudden neurologic change. Contact a veterinarian or appropriate emergency professional promptly; a concern that first appears to involve parasite prevention and monitoring may still be medical. Do not give human medication, leftover antibiotics, unselected parasite products, or force food or water unless a veterinarian directs the exact action. For wildlife or legally restricted species, a wildlife or public-health authority may also need to guide safe handling and disposition.
